Abstract Stable and sufficient nursing workforce is vital for the quality of patient care. The Ministry of Education enthusiastically cultivates nursing students every year in hopes of that all the nursing students will apply their knowledge, enrich the nursing workforce, and provide optimal care quality after graduating from schools. However, the responses after such a long time are still that each medical organization gradually reduces the sickbeds due to insufficient nursing workforce. A great number of studies show that work stress from nursing is a critical factor that nurses refuse to work as nurses. Do nursing graduates change their careers in advance since they feel the stress even before becoming nurses? This study was aimed to investigate work stress expected from nursing by nursing graduates from different school systems and factors in nursing career aspirations. A cross-sectional study design and a structured questionnaire were employed in this study, and convenience sampling of groups was used to investigate 878 nursing graduates from universities, two-year colleges, four-year colleges, and five-year junior colleges, who were in the second semester of the 101 school year. According to the research result, (1) the overall expected work stress expected by the graduates from universities was the highest, followed by respectively two-year colleges, five-year junior colleges, and four-year colleges. (2) The stress that the graduates felt from the dimension of “work tasks” was the highest among the dimensions of expected work stress. (3) The graduates from four-year colleges had the highest career recognition for nursing whereas the graduates from universities had the lowest career recognition for nursing. (4) Nursing career recognition and expected work stress were significantly negatively correlated, indicating that the higher one’s nursing recognition is, the lower the work stress is. (5) Although nursing work stress is high, 85.3% of the nursing graduates still would like to work in clinic nursing after graduating from schools. Meanwhile, 16.63% of the graduates chose further education, career change, or others. This indicates that a great number of graduates may start their nursing careers with a wait-and-see attitude, and they may change their jobs once their work stress increases, or their job satisfaction reduces. It is thus suggested that nursing superintendents should make work plans suitable for new nursing graduates and provide counseling systems in order to reduce the uncertainty of new nursing graduates, increase the retention rate, and maintain the professional commitment of nurses for nursing.

Повний текст джерелаCaring for intellectually disabled people can be demanding for student nurses who are still novices in the profession. To ensure optimal nursing care is received, student nurses must have both an understanding of and a positive attitude towards intellectually disabled people. Nursing intellectually disabled people is a challenge that can have an impact on a person‟s body, mind and spirit therefore, student nurses need to have the ability to deal with stressful situations and environments. Student nurses need to be prepared to care for patients with long-term challenges, such as intellectual disabilities. These patients require a caring relationship that facilitates an enhanced awareness of life and health experiences. The caring relationship also facilitates health and healing processes as it involves the authentic and genuine needs of patients. This research aimed to explore and describe lived experiences of student nurses caring for intellectually disabled people in a public psychiatric institution, and to formulate guidelines for the facilitation of mental health of these student nurses. A qualitative, exploratory, descriptive and contextual design was used. Data were collected through individual in-depth interviews, focusing on the question “How was it for you to be working at this institution?” Thematic analysis was used to analyse the collected data and a consensus discussion was held with the independent coder. Ten participants were interviewed and five, who were not comfortable with interviews, wrote naïve sketches. Trustworthiness was assured by adhering to Lincoln and Guba‟s principles, that is, credibility, transferability, dependability, and confirmability. Four ethical principles were demonstrated throughout the research namely, principles of respect for autonomy, non-maleficence, beneficence, and justice. Three themes emerged from the data. Firstly, student nurses experience a profound unsettling impact on their wholistic being when caring for intellectually disabled people. iv Secondly, they develop a sense of compassion and a new way of looking at life, and lastly they require certain educational, emotional and spiritual needs to be met. Guidelines were formulated to facilitate the mental health of student nurses caring for intellectually disabled people in a public psychiatric institution.

Повний текст джерелаAlthough all students planning to do the B.Cur.-degree at the Rand Afrikaans University are subjected to a selection procedure, the attrition rate for the course is considerable. In 1975, only nine of the original 23 students graduated, and in 1976 only ten of the original 31 students were able to complete the course. An attempt was made to evaluate the present selection process which consists of a slidingscale and a structured interview. The sample consisted of all students registering for the B.Cur.-degree from 1975 to 1980. Findings are based on data gathered from selection records and records of academic achievement as well as a structured interview with all applicants. The findings consist of the following - if the slidingscale is to be used in future, students in the catagories 50-59 and 60-69 may be reconsidered for entrance - in the catagories 90-99 and 100+, 46,9 per cent of the students resigned in their first year and research in this connection would be of value the fact that a course is selected as a major, does not seem to be related to academic success, especially during the first year of study - there seems to be a significant positive relationship between the structured interview and academic success. Although research of this specific nature has not yet been replicated, the findings could, however, be seen as representative of B.Cur. students in the Republic of South Africa.
